Tubi The Free Streaming Service, Hits 74 Million Monthly Active Users & Almost 250 Free Live Channels As Cord Cutting Grows

Tubi is a rare success story in streaming.

One of the fastest-growing areas in cord cutting is free ad-supported streaming. Now we get an idea of just how large it is thanks to new numbers from Tubi that show the service now has 74 million active monthly users, up from the 64 million monthly active users it reported in February.

As inflation hits, streamers increasingly streamers are cutting back on the number of streaming services they pay for. This has helped free services like Tubi attract new users looking for cheaper options.

“Tubi is now watched as much as a top 5 cable network, as audiences continue to embrace our digital-first, 100% free streaming experience,” said Anjali Sud, newly appointed CEO of Tubi. “The platform continues to scale with 47% growth in ad revenue and 65% growth in total viewing time Q4 over Q4, and we are executing an ambitious strategy to define the next generation of entertainment through our diverse content, passionate audience and innovative tech platform.”

Tubi also now has over 200,000 movies and TV episodes on-demand, along with almost 250 free live channels. Tubi also announced that its Tubi Originals that first launched in June 2021 now have over 200 titles watched by 54 million viewers.

Tubi also says its fastest-growing market is 18-34 amount African Americans, Asians, Hispanics, and Multicultural audiences as they saw over 50% growth. Over all, Tubi saw audience growth of over 30%.

Tubi and other free ad-supported streaming services are behind, helped by a growing demand for cheaper options as inflation puts pressure on Americans to cut back on streaming costs.
